Details of Innovation There is a local saying in Surendranagar that drought teaches a lot. During 1986-88 also, when there was drought in this region, it was a time for learning. It was during the drought that the farmers learnt how to save their cattle. At that time, the people were able to save therir cattle with milk hedge (Euphorbia neriifolia) plant found in desert areas. They used the method of "dandalis" to get cattlefeed out of the plant. The method the people used to prepare cattlefeed is as follows: 1 First cut milk hedge and bring it home. 2 Cut the milk hedge stem into small pieces and split it vertically and press it in the middle. 3 Thereafter add molasses and salt and press and tie the pieces into bundles. Then feed these to cattle. 4 The cattle feed and relish the milk hedge pieces that are nutritious also. Milk hedge is a herb that cannot be eaten raw. Hence, the elaborate preparation has to be made. The simple reason for the effort is milk hedge is easliy available. Besides, it grows well in times of drought, budding and blossoming.
